虚拟列表技术通过动态计算和按需渲染,解决了大量DOM元素导致的性能问题。其核心思想是根据可视区域渲染部分数据,分为定高和不定高两种类型。实现过程中,使用原生JS创建虚拟列表,计算可视区域高度、渲染项数,并绑定滚动事件以动态更新内容,从而提升页面性能,避免卡顿和白屏现象。
瀑布流布局在多页滚动加载时性能下降,可通过虚拟列表优化,结合JavaScript和CSS实现。使用ResizeObserver监测动态列数,确保流畅过渡。同时需处理可视元素判定和滚动事件的性能问题,以避免抖动和动画缺失。
完成下面两步后,将自动完成登录并继续当前操作。